Mr. Drew grows green pepper plants in planters.

The graph shows the relationship between the number of planters and the number of pepper plants. How many pepper plants are in 3 planters?

A graph shows green pepper plants by planters. A line starts at (0, 0) and passes through (4, 12).

18

12

9

3

Answer:

Option (3)

Explanation:

From the graph attached,

For a point (x, y),

x-coordinate shows the planters and y-coordinate show the number of green pepper plants in the planters.

If input value (x-value) for the line is 3,

Output value (y-value) from the graph will be, y = 9.

Therefore, there are 9 green pepper plants in 3 planters.

Therefore, Option (3) is the correct option.
